jennifer abessira Tag Archive


Artipoeus Episode 45 – London Bridge is (not) Falling Down

London Bridge is (not) Falling Down Artipoeus visits Jennifer Abessira’s installation, “Don’t Think Twice,” at London Bridge Station in London, England. Listen to this article on Soundcloud:   “Don’t Think Twice,” by Jennifer Abessira 2017 Someone told me recently that my habit of following a train of thought all the way to the end is self-indulgent. In short, that I […]

Read More